Hello folks!
I'd like to gauge interest in an in-person sprint supporting the
Automation & Systematization goal. Right now we are targeting Berlin on
April 19th - April 24th. KDE e.V. has budget available to help with
travel and lodging costs.
This will be a triple-threat sprint, with the Accessibility and
Sustainability sprints co-located. People interested in multiple topics
will be able to jump between them if they want.
Topics for the Automation & Systematization sprint might include:
- Writing tests
- Fixing failing tests
- Making tests mandatory to pass
- Documenting how to write good tests
- Updating outdated documentation
- Transition documentation to code (e.g. making kdesrc-build or the new
kde-builder tool do more itself, so we don't have to write so much about
it in our documentation)
- Make a push for enabling clang-format for more repos
- Make a push to put release notes in AppStream metadata
- Improve our AppStream CI job to require or recommend more things
- Make a CI job to enforce as much of the onboarding/new repo checklist
as possible, and make enabling it be a part of the process
These are just ideas; the folks who attend will be the ones who guide
the agenda.
